Ankara is the capital of Türkiye and one of the most important cities in the country. Located in central Anatolia, the city is known for its rich history and culture, as well as its political, economic and cultural importance. Ankara's population is approximately 5. 5 million, making it the second largest city in Turkey after Istanbul.
Ankara is a modern and vibrant city with many attractions for visitors. Ankara Citadel is one of the most popular tourist spots in the city, offering breathtaking views of the city. The Museum of Anatolian Civilizations is another highlight, displaying artifacts and relics from the many different civilizations that inhabited the region.
In addition, the city is an important commercial and business center, home to many international and national companies, as well as the seat of the Turkish government. Ankara is also an important cultural center with many theatres, art galleries, cinemas and other entertainment venues.
Overall, Ankara is a fascinating and diverse city, offering visitors a unique blend of history, culture, business and leisure.

Antalya is a city in southern Turkey located in the Mediterranean region, capital of the metropolitan area and the province of Antalya.
Built on cliffs by the sea, the city is surrounded by mountains. Investments made from the 1970s onwards transformed the city into a tourist center of international fame.
Antalya's economy mainly depends on tourism, agriculture, commerce and some light industry. Among the agricultural products, citrus, bananas, cotton, flowers, olives and olive oil stand out. 65% of the demand for fresh fruit and vegetables is met by the municipal wholesale market complex in Antalya.

Istanbul, formerly Byzantium and Constantinople, is the largest city in Turkey and the fourth largest in the world, rivaling London for the most populous city in Europe.
The city occupies both the banks of the Bosphorus and the north of the Sea of Marmara, which separate Asia from Europe in a north-south direction, a situation that makes Istanbul the only city that occupies two continents. The central part of the European part is in turn divided by the estuary of the Golden Horn. It is usual to say that the city has two or three centers, depending on whether or not one considers that in the Asian part there is also a center.

Ankara Esenboğa Airport ( ICAO: LTAC , IATA: ESB) is the international airport serving the capital city Ankara. It has been operating since 1955 and it ranks 5th in terms of passenger traffic among airports in Turkey, with 13,7M passengers in 2019. The airport is located northeast of Ankara, 28 km from the city center.
The airport currently has two parallel runways, one of which is CAT III. A new parallel runway is under construction to the east of the terminal. The airport also hosts ATC training center and the simulator building. There is also the Grand Honor Hall (Foreign Guests Mansion) for state protocol and for foreign high rank visitors. The current new domestic and international flights terminal building was completed in 2006.
The airport is a hub for AnadoluJet and Turkish Airlines.
